Output 582687586e2fa32c3a1efbd9ed712b8828c76e85e12f6d3f33e34072926f2612:0

value
9727195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 947f051d15185a569202b75ea1c7b9d2800bfdf4 OP_EQUAL
address
3FEC6SK8fcXBq7yNRPzFuXYyPccU2g3qRp
transaction
582687586e2fa32c3a1efbd9ed712b8828c76e85e12f6d3f33e34072926f2612
confirmations
322544
spent
true